I'm interested to see what will happen with BT Sport. I suspect a lot of people are like me and subscribed to the other stuff on the strength of having ESPN and especially ESPN America.
Without those, if BT isn't included in the XL package there is no reason for me to even have Virginmedia TV, and without the TV then there is no reason for the phone/broadband. I'll probably switch to some other deal. I would imagine I'm not the only one considering that. |

---------- Post added at 17:28 ---------- Previous post was at 17:26 ---------- SECTIONS BT Sport set to strike Virgin Media carriage deal 29 JULY, 2013 | BY PETER WHITE Virgin Media is poised to close a deal to carry BT Sport’s three sports channels on its cable TV platform, making them available to a further 4m potential customers. The two companies have been in negotiations for a number of months but both have been keen to strike a deal ahead of BT Sport’s launch on Thursday 1 August. BT Sport has the rights to the Scottish Premier League, which begins its season on Friday 2 August,and wanted to have carriage on Virgin in time for its first TV game - Partick Thistle versus Dundee United - so as not to alienate football fans who are VM customers. The English Premier League season starts on August 17th. One of the sticking points of negotiations has been whether Virgin will bundle the new channels in with its TV XL premium package - as was previously the case with ESPN - or whether it will charge for them as a standalone product. It is not clear which route has been taken, but a Virgin Media spokesman said: We’re always looking bring the best possible value and choice of great quality content to our customers and we’re talking to BT about how we could potentially make the forthcoming BT Sport package available.” Earlier this year, Virgin Media sent an online survey out to customers asking whether they would be willing to pay slightly more for their top package if it were to include Premier League football and Sky Atlantic, which could pave the way for this move. BT Sport is being sold as a standalone channel on the Sky platform for £12 a month in SD and £15 a month in HD |
